Why are Italy famous for pizza?

1. Italy is considered the birthplace of pizza.

* Pizza's origins can be traced back to ancient Greece, when flatbreads were sprinkled with olive oil, herbs, and cheese.

* The first pizzas similar to the ones we know today were created in Naples in the late 18th century.

* Neapolitan pizza is renowned for its thin, crispy crust and use of fresh, high-quality ingredients, such as tomatoes, mozzarella cheese, and basil.

2. Italy has a long tradition of pizza-making.

* Pizza is a staple food in Italy and is enjoyed by people of all ages and backgrounds.

* There are countless pizza restaurants in Italy, each with its own unique take on the classic dish.

* Pizza-making is often passed down from generation to generation, with family recipes and traditions carefully guarded.

3. Italian pizza has been recognized for its cultural significance.

* In 2017, Neapolitan pizza was inscribed on UNESCO's Representative List of the Intangible Cultural Heritage of Humanity.

* This recognition highlights the importance of pizza in Italian culture and its contribution to the country's culinary heritage.

Today, Italian pizza is enjoyed all over the world and has become one of the most popular dishes in the world.
